Noting the increase among faculty of people of color, women and those identifying as nonbinary, as well as the decrease of white men in tenure-track jobs, the commission opened an investigation into the university’s hiring practices.

The Trump administration launched multiple investigations and funding cuts against Harvard, alleging antisemitism and challenging admissions policies. Harvard sued, claiming government overreach.
